From d48979091efe58ce00cafbb61cc9cae26e16669b Mon Sep 17 00:00:00 2001 From: Brecht Van Lommel Date: Sun, 17 Nov 2013 10:21:38 +0100 Subject: [PATCH] Maniphest: order open tasks by date created and don't group by priority, to make it more like the old bug tracker. Also makes count bugs fairly easy by just looking at the number on the second or third page. --- .../maniphest/query/ManiphestTaskSearchEngine.php |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) diff --git a/src/applications/maniphest/query/ManiphestTaskSearchEngine.php b/src/applications/maniphest/query/ManiphestTaskSearchEngine.php index f9e409573c..4207cbd57b 100644 --- a/src/applications/maniphest/query/ManiphestTaskSearchEngine.php +++ b/src/applications/maniphest/query/ManiphestTaskSearchEngine.php @@ -415,14 +415,18 @@ final class ManiphestTaskSearchEngine switch ($query_key) { case 'all': - return $query; + return $query + ->setParameter('order', 'created') + ->setParameter('group', 'none'); case 'assigned': return $query ->setParameter('assignedPHIDs', array($viewer_phid)) ->setParameter('statuses', array(ManiphestTaskStatus::STATUS_OPEN)); case 'open': return $query - ->setParameter('statuses', array(ManiphestTaskStatus::STATUS_OPEN)); + ->setParameter('statuses', array(ManiphestTaskStatus::STATUS_OPEN)) + ->setParameter('order', 'created') + ->setParameter('group', 'none'); case 'authored': return $query ->setParameter('authorPHIDs', array($viewer_phid))